Курс PHP. Профессиональная разработка на PHP5

В курсе рассматриваются темы — ООП, XML, Веб-сервисы, без которых немыслима профессиональная разработка приложений на PHP, что позволяет создавать сложные Интернет сайты, интегрированные с внешними данными.

Возможная должность: помощник разработчика, младший разработчик (junior)

Ориентировочная зарплата:

  • 12 000 – 16 000 грн.
  • 4 недель
  • 36 академ часов
  • 3200 гривен

По окончании курса Вы будете уметь:

  • Использовать объектно-ориентированное программирование в PHP
  • Использовать базы данных SQLite
  • Использовать SimpleXML и DOM разбор XML документов в PHP
  • Использовать XSLT преобразования в PHP
  • Создавать и использовать XML Web сервисы с помощью протоколов SOAP и XML-RPC
  • Использовать сокеты
  • Использовать графический модуль GD2

Получить бесплатную консультацию по курсу:

  • что вы получите на курсе
  • как проходит обучение
  • какая практика есть на курсе
  • какие программы изучаются
  • какие навыки вы получите
  • кто преподаватели и какой у них опыт
  • какая поддержка есть на курсе

     

    Программа курса PHP программирование

    Модуль 1. Объектно-ориентированное программирование на PHP

    • ООП в PHP — введение
    • Классы
    • Свойства и методы
    • Конструкторы и деструкторы
    • Клонирование объектов
    • Наследование
    • Перегрузка методов
    • Методы доступа к свойствам и методам
    • Обработка исключений
    • Константы класса
    • Абстрактные классы и методы
    • Интерфейсы
    • Финальные классы и методы
    • Статические свойства и методы класса
    • «Магические методы»
    • Уточнение типа (type-hint)
    • Типажи (traits)
    • Другие полезные мелочи

    Лабораторные работы

    Модуль 2. PHP и XML

    • Введение в XML
    • Обзор возможностей по работе PHP с технологией XML
      • SAX
      • DOM
      • SimpleXML
      • XMLReader и XMLWriter
    • Обзор XSL/T
    • Преобразование данных на сервере

    Лабораторные работы

    Модуль 3. PHP и XML Web-services

    • Введение в XML Web-services
    • Обзор RPC
    • Обзор SOAP
    • Использование расширения SOAP
    • Использование WSDL
    • Обзор XML-RPC
    • Использование расширения XML-RPC
    • Использование контекста потока

    Лабораторные работы

    Модуль 4. Сокеты и сетевые функции

    • Соединение с удаленными узлами через сокеты
    • Сетевые функции
    • Лабораторная работа

    Модуль 5. Работа с графикой

    • Введение в графические форматы
    • Вопросы генерации графики на PHP 5
    • Использование расширения GD2
    • Базовые функции для работы с графикой
    • Лабораторная работа

    Оборудованные аудитории

    Наша школа оборудована всем необходимым:

    • Комфортные аудитории
    • Техника которая настроена под задачи курса
    • Современные компьютеры
    • Удобные стулья и мебель
    • Приветливый персонал, готовый решить любой вопрос
    • Преподаватели профи своего дела
    • Умеем преподавать
    • Никакой воды, только полезная информация

    Получить бесплатную консультацию по курсу:

    • что вы получите на курсе
    • как проходит обучение
    • какая практика есть на курсе
    • какие программы изучаются
    • какие навыки вы получите
    • кто преподаватели и какой у них опыт
    • какая поддержка есть на курсе